Finding Amanda
When it comes to screwing up their lives, some people don't know when to cry uncle.
When it comes to screwing up their lives, some people don't know when...
Comedy, Drama - 2008
5.5
40%
51
A television producer with a penchant for drinking and gambling is sent to Las Vegas to convince his troubled niece to enter rehab.

Top Critics Reviews

rotten:
Offers a steady supply of clever lines but suffers from the patina of self-loathing common to industry lifers and the unfortunate miscasting of straight-arrow Broderick as a depressed, cynical hack.
– J. R. Jones,
Chicago Reader,
9 Dec 2008
fresh:
A very darkly humorous film.
– John Anderson,
Newsday,
18 Oct 2008
fresh:
Matthew Broderick regains his cinematic stride as a morosely wise-cracking television producer on the skids, ably abetted by Maura Tierney as his much-put-upon wife and Brittany Snow as his perky prostitute niece.
– Ronnie Scheib,
Variety,
18 Oct 2008
rotten:
Broderick's sunny spin on the deeply flawed Taylor is interesting but eventually defies belief. In the third act, Finding Amanda loses steam altogether.
– Richard Roeper,
Ebert & Roeper,
30 Jun 2008
rotten:
Finding Amanda has some of the good and a lot of the bad aspects of a first film written and directed by the same person.
– Mick LaSalle,
San Francisco Chronicle,
27 Jun 2008
